A question to Chiif and Jon, is there a reason why the 28mm f2 is not prefered over the f3.5 lens?
 

A question to Chiif and Jon, is there a reason why the 28mm f2 is not prefered over the f3.5 lens?

I wouldn't say one is preferred over the other, but for sure the combination of tiny size and excellent optical quality is the reason the 28mm f3.5 is so popular.

The 28mm f2 is also an excellent lens, but its extra 1 and 2/3 stops of light gathering power results in a lens that is a looooot bigger than the tiny 28mm f3.5. If you want fast AND wide, there aren't many other choice that give you as much bang for your buck as the 28mm f2.

Haha, what are some of the other choices? Mind sharing? I was reading on a review of this lens and apparently had quite a high feedback on this.

I probably missed some, but the ones that come to mind are the CV 28mm f/1.9 and Summicron 28mm f/2 ASPH, then if you want to go wider there's the Summilux 24mm f/1.4 ASPH and Summilux 21mm f/1.4 ASPH. Anything with ASPH in its name means BIG $$$ :sweat:
